Title: DOOR LOCK: POWER DOOR LOCK CONTROL SYSTEM: DESCRIPTION (2008 LX570)

All Doors LOCK/UNLOCK Functions do not Operate Via Door Control Switch

DESCRIPTION

The main body ECU receives switch signals from the door control switch and activates the door lock motor on each door according to these signals.

INSPECTION PROCEDURE

PROCEDURE

1.

READ VALUE USING TECHSTREAM (DOOR LOCK AND UNLOCK SWITCH)

(a) Use the Data List to check if the door lock and unlock switches are functioning properly.

2.

INSPECT FUSE (DOOR NO. 1, DOOR NO. 2)

(a) Remove the DOOR NO. 1 fuse from the main body ECU.

(b) Remove the DOOR NO. 2 fuse from the engine room No. 1 relay block.

(c) Measure the resistance according to the value(s) in the table below.
